The National Institutes of Health must restore hundreds of recently canceled research grants focused on race, gender and sexual orientation, a federal judge ordered June 16. The federal government announced in February it would terminate NIH grants related to diversity,
A federal judge ruled directives from the Trump administration that led to the cancellations of research grants from the NIH were "void" and "illegal."
A federal judge in Massachusetts has ruled that hundreds of grants terminated by the National Institutes of Health (NIH) must be restored immediately, the latest legal victory for groups challenging the Trump administration’s cuts to federal science funding.
